Block 585,505
Block Hash
c37567a2056c3390e4e7f75df25d3867337d06d9dc8b7813a713b99bc1fa115e
Previous Block Hash
fbb67b758e53f4b1dc08525e968961b4e9c246659fb516b6e47af42a93e3eeb2
Mined
Transactions
3
Difficulty
26.22 M
Size
622 bytes
Transactions (3)
1 input, 1 output
15,625.00452
PEPE
1 input, 2 outputs
10,839.9232
PEPE
1 input, 2 outputs
11,059.81496
PEPE